Gwinnett police warning of phone scams

By Caleb Hutchins Assistant News Director

Gwinnett County authorities are warning the public about phone scammers posing as law enforcement.

A release from the Gwinnett County Police Department Tuesday said several residents have reported calls that appear to come from the police department telling them they've missed a court appearance and have been sent subpoenas. Police officials said the county police department is not involved with issuing subpoenas for court appearances.

While authorities say these scammers did not immediately ask for money, they warned that often times, scammers posing as law enforcement will. They offered several tips to avoid being victimized.

  • Always ask for the caller's identity and contact the agency immediately.
  • Never disclose personal or financial information to unsolicited callers or by email
  • Never wire money or provide bank account information to anyone you do not know

Anyone who believes they have been targeted or victimized by a phone scam is asked to contact Gwinnett police by calling 770-513-5700.
